1. Getting Started: Registration & Verification

First things first – you need an account before you can place a wager or spin a reel. The registration form on Pointsbet is straightforward: name, date of birth, email and a secure password. Australian players will also be asked for a residential address to satisfy local licensing rules.

After you hit “Sign Up”, the verification step kicks in. Pointsbet uses a standard KYC (Know Your Customer) process, which means you’ll be asked to upload a photo of your driver’s licence or passport and a recent utility bill. The upload is done through a secure portal, and most users get approved within a few hours, sometimes even minutes if everything looks clear.

3. Deposit and Withdrawal Methods – Speed and Security

When it comes to moving money, Pointsbet supports the major Australian payment methods: Visa, Mastercard, POLi, and PayID. Deposits are processed instantly, so you can start betting straight away. Most players prefer PayID because it links directly to a bank account and avoids extra fees.

Withdrawals are a bit slower, but still within industry norms. The standard processing time is 1–3 business days for bank transfers, while e‑wallets such as PayPal or Skrill can be cleared in under 24 hours. Pointsbet does not charge a withdrawal fee, but your bank may apply its own charges.

4. Sportsbook and Live Betting Features

The core of Pointsbet is its sportsbook, covering everything from AFL and NRL to cricket, soccer and international tennis. The platform offers conventional fixed‑odds betting and a “Pointsbetting” option that lets you multiply your stake based on how right you are – a fun twist for seasoned punters.

Live betting is available on most major events, with in‑play odds updating every few seconds. The interface shows a mini‑scoreboard, a quick‑bet panel and a cash‑out button, which lets you lock in profit or cut losses before the final whistle.

7. Responsible Gambling and Player Protection

Pointsbet takes responsible gambling seriously. Every account comes with built‑in tools: deposit limits, loss limits, session timers and self‑exclusion options. If you ever feel you need a break, you can activate a 24‑hour, 7‑day or permanent self‑exclusion directly from your profile.

The site also partners with Australian responsible‑gaming organisations, offering links to counselling services and financial advice.
